What Is Chromium And Why Picolinate?

Chromium as a dietary supplement is an essential trace mineral your body needs in tiny amounts to process carbohydrates, fats, and protein. It acts as a cofactor for insulin—the hormone that moves glucose from your blood into your cells for energy. Without enough chromium, insulin signaling can become less efficient, which may contribute to blood sugar swings and increased fat storage.

You can get chromium from foods like:

  • Beef, turkey, and poultry

  • Broccoli, green beans, and potatoes with skin

  • Oats, barley, and whole-wheat bran

  • Apples, bananas, nuts, seeds, and mushrooms

Dietary intake, however, is often low and highly variable because soil quality and processing strip much of the mineral out. That’s where supplementation comes in.

Chromium is sold in several forms:

  • Chromium picolinate – chromium bound to picolinic acid; this is the best-studied form for blood sugar and chromium picolinate for weight loss applications.

  • Chromium nicotinate / polynicotinate – bound to niacin (vitamin B3); also well absorbed and sometimes used for lipid support.

  • Chromium yeast – chromium bound to amino acids in yeast; mimics food-bound chromium.

  • Chromium chloride – inexpensive but poorly absorbed; not ideal if you care about consistent results.

Because of its higher bioavailability and the volume of research behind it, most protocols that use chromium picolinate for weight loss and metabolic support rely on the picolinate form.

How Chromium Picolinate Works In The Body

The reason people turn to chromium picolinate for weight loss is its impact on several core pathways: insulin sensitivity, blood sugar stability, brain chemistry, and possibly thermogenesis and lean mass.

Insulin, Blood Sugar, And Fat Storage

Chromium enhancing insulin receptor activity at cellular level

Chromium helps insulin work more efficiently by binding to a peptide called chromodulin (low-molecular-weight chromium-binding substance). When insulin attaches to its receptor on a cell, chromium is pulled into the cell and amplifies that signal. The result:

  • Better insulin sensitivity

  • More efficient glucose uptake into muscle and other tissues

  • Reduced need for high insulin output after meals

From a body-composition perspective, this matters. Chronically elevated insulin promotes fat storage and makes it harder to access stored fat. When you use chromium picolinate for weight loss, you’re not “melting fat” directly; you’re fine-tuning the hormonal environment so your body is less biased toward storing calories as fat.

Brain Chemistry, Appetite, And Cravings

Beyond insulin, chromium appears to influence neurotransmitters involved in mood, reward, and appetite—especially dopamine and serotonin. This is where chromium picolinate for weight loss intersects with binge eating, carb cravings, and emotional snacking.

By smoothing out blood sugar swings and supporting more stable dopamine activity, chromium may:

  • Reduce intense cravings for sugar and refined carbs

  • Lower the urge for “reward eating” under stress or low mood

  • Help some people feel more satisfied after meals

What The Research Really Shows About Chromium Picolinate For Weight Loss

The big question: does chromium picolinate for weight loss actually move the scale in a meaningful way?

A meta-analysis of the effect of chromium supplementation on anthropometric indices shows a fairly consistent picture:

  • A Cochrane review pooling 9 RCTs (622 overweight or obese adults, 200–1000 mcg/day for 12–16 weeks) found that chromium picolinate users lost about 1.1 kg (~2.4 lb) more than placebo.

  • Another review of 21 trials with over 1,300 participants reported small but statistically significant reductions in body weight, BMI, and body fat percentage—especially in studies around 400 mcg/day lasting up to 12 weeks.

Key takeaways:

  • The average weight loss from chromium picolinate for weight loss alone is modest, on the order of a couple of pounds over three to four months.

  • There is no clear dose-response curve—1,000 mcg/day did not consistently outperform 400 mcg/day.

  • Effects on waist circumference and BMI are inconsistent and often not statistically significant.

In other words, chromium picolinate for weight loss is not a standalone fat-loss method. It’s best understood as a metabolic support tool that:

  • Slightly boosts the results you get from a calorie deficit, training, and sleep

  • Helps reduce the behavioral friction (cravings, energy crashes) that make staying on plan hard

PCOS, Female Hormones, And Cravings

Polycystic Ovary Syndrome (PCOS) is tightly linked to insulin resistance. A meta-analysis of seven RCTs in women with PCOS found that chromium supplementation:

  • Reduced BMI

  • Lowered fasting insulin

  • Decreased free testosterone

Other reproductive hormones (LH, FSH, DHEA) were less affected, so chromium is not a complete hormonal fix—but it can help with the metabolic core of PCOS. For many women, that translates into:

  • Easier weight management

  • Less severe carb cravings

  • More stable energy throughout the day

Dosing Chromium Picolinate For Weight Loss And Metabolic Support

There’s a big difference between the amount of chromium you need for basic health and the amounts studied in chromium picolinate for weight loss and metabolic trials.

Daily Intake Vs. Therapeutic Doses

Nutrient-dense chromium-rich vegetables and whole grains

Adequate intake from food alone is low:

  • Adult men: ~35 mcg/day

  • Adult women: ~20–25 mcg/day

Clinical studies on chromium picolinate for weight loss and insulin sensitivity typically use:

  • 200–1,000 mcg/day of chromium picolinate

  • Most positive data clusters around 400–600 mcg/day

More is not always better. Research has not shown clear advantages for 1,000 mcg over 400–600 mcg, and higher doses may carry more risk for sensitive individuals.

How To Take It

Common best practices if you’re using chromium picolinate for weight loss and metabolic support:

  • Split the dose – for example, 200–300 mcg with breakfast and again with your largest carb-containing meal.

  • Take it with food – this may support absorption and reduce the chance of stomach discomfort.

  • Pair with co-factors – vitamin C and niacin (B3) support chromium absorption; whole-food meals rich in these nutrients can help.

Safety, Side Effects, And Interactions

At doses up to 1,000 mcg/day, chromium picolinate is generally well tolerated in short- to medium-term studies. Still, any serious stack should factor in risk.

Common, Usually Mild Effects

Some people report:

  • Nausea or stomach discomfort

  • Watery stools or diarrhea

  • Headaches or dizziness

These are typically mild and often fade as your body adjusts. Taking chromium with food can help.

Potential Serious Risks (Rare But Important)

There are rare case reports and limited trial data suggesting that high-dose or prolonged use might stress the liver or kidneys in susceptible individuals. A few serious adverse events occurred in trials using 400–1,000 mcg/day, though causality is unclear.

You should be especially cautious—and talk with a clinician—if you:

  • Have kidney or liver disease

  • Are pregnant or breastfeeding

  • Take insulin or other glucose-lowering medications (risk of hypoglycemia)

  • Use drugs that interact with blood sugar or kidney function

Bottom Line: Does Chromium Picolinate Deliver?

Used alone, chromium picolinate for weight loss delivers small but measurable reductions in body weight—typically a few pounds over several months. That’s not the dramatic effect some marketing suggests, and it shouldn’t replace nutrition, training, sleep, or stress management.

Used intelligently, though, chromium picolinate for weight loss can:

  • Make it easier to stay in a calorie deficit by smoothing energy and cravings

  • Support insulin sensitivity and overall metabolic health, particularly in insulin resistance and PCOS
